The Defense Logistics Agency needs a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business to manufacture fuel injector nozzles.

Key Details

What exactly do they need? - The Defense Logistics Agency needs a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business to manufacture fuel injector nozzles for delivery to W1A8 DLA Distribution within 95 days.

What's the contract structure and timeline? - The solicitation is a Request for Quote (RFQ) with no specifications, plans, or drawings available.

How will they pick the winner? - The notice doesn't say.

When and how do you bid? - Submit a quote electronically by June 15, 2026.

Who can apply

  • Must be a certified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business (SDVOSB)

If you're interested, do this first

  • Check that your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business certification is still active in SAM.gov
  • Review the solicitation link provided in the notice to understand the requirements
